How they compare
Zambia currently reports 1,349 t against 1,252 t in Ghana, a difference of 97 t.
That makes Zambia's figure about 1.1 times Ghana's.
The two have swapped places 9 times across 25 shared years of data; in 1988 it was Zambia ahead.
Ghana ranks 65th and Zambia ranks 63rd of 108 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Ghana averaged higher in 2 and Zambia in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ghana | Zambia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 84,964 t | 86,306 t | 1,342 t | Zambia |
| 1990s | 80,689 t | 98,040 t | 17,351 t | Zambia |
| 2000s | 54,380 t | 34,460 t | 19,921 t | Ghana |
| 2010s | 9,452 t | 1,690 t | 7,762 t | Ghana |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
